1. HubSpot: The foundational b2b buyer persona template
HubSpot’s collection is often the first stop for marketers creating a b2b buyer persona template, and for good reason. It provides a comprehensive, yet straightforward, starting point that covers all the essential bases without overwhelming you with unnecessary fields. This makes it ideal for teams that are new to persona development or those looking to standardize their existing process with a trusted framework.
What sets HubSpot's offering apart is its user-friendly presentation. The templates are available in multiple formats, but the PowerPoint version is particularly useful. It guides you through a step-by-step creation process, asking targeted questions to help you build out each section, from job responsibilities and goals to challenges and communication preferences. This guided approach ensures you don't miss critical details.
While the template is excellent for foundational work, it can feel a bit general for highly niche or complex B2B SaaS industries. Teams in these spaces may need to add custom fields to capture specific technical pain points or intricate buying committee dynamics. 2. Semrush: The data-driven b2b buyer persona template
Semrush offers a dynamic, browser-based tool that moves beyond static files to create a more interactive b2b buyer persona template. It's an excellent choice for teams already embedded in the Semrush ecosystem, allowing them to directly apply insights from their keyword and market research into their persona development. The platform offers a clean, user-friendly interface with pre-built templates specifically for B2B scenarios.
What makes the Semrush tool particularly powerful is its built-in guidance. As you fill out sections like "Goals," "Frustrations," or "Watering Holes," the tool provides tips on where to source this information, often pointing to other Semrush features. This creates a seamless workflow from raw data analysis to a polished persona profile, ensuring your decisions are backed by research rather than assumptions.
While the persona builder itself is free, its true value is unlocked when paired with a paid Semrush subscription. Without it, you’re manually inputting data that could be more efficiently gathered from their analytics suite. 3. Miro: The collaborative b2b buyer persona template
Miro takes the static document and transforms it into a dynamic, collaborative workspace. Its value isn't in providing a unique set of fields, but in how it enables teams to build their b2b buyer persona template together in real time. This makes it an exceptional tool for remote or hybrid teams running workshops to define and align on who their ideal customer is. The visual, sticky-note-style interface encourages brainstorming and iterative refinement.
What makes Miro stand out is its function as a living document. Personas built here are not meant to be filed away; they can be easily updated after a round of customer interviews or a shift in market dynamics. The template is a launchpad, connecting to a vast library of other strategic frameworks like customer journey maps and empathy maps, allowing you to build a comprehensive view of your buyer. The primary drawback is that unlocking its full collaborative power requires a paid Miro subscription. While the free tier is great for individual use or small-scale tests, true team-wide co-creation and private board management are premium features.

From Template to Strategy: Your Next Steps
Downloading a template is the first step. True implementation requires a commitment to using the insights you've gathered. Here’s how to move forward:
- Centralize Your Personas: Don't let your newly created personas get lost in a random folder. Store them in a central, accessible location like a shared drive, your company's internal wiki, or your CRM.
- Integrate Into Onboarding: Make your B2B buyer personas a core part of the training process for new hires, especially those in sales, marketing, and customer support. This ensures everyone starts with a customer-centric mindset.
- Review and Refine Regularly: Markets shift, customer needs evolve, and your product changes. Schedule a quarterly or semi-annual review of your personas to ensure they still accurately reflect your ideal customer. Use new data from sales calls and customer feedback to keep them fresh.
